Event Overview: The event aimed to engage, educate, and entertain six-year-old children in a fun and interactive environment. It featured various activities, games, educational exhibits, and live performances to cater to their specific developmental needs and interests. The event organizers were keen on receiving feedback from the attendees to improve future events and create an even more meaningful experience for young children. Survey Results: 1. Favorite Activities: The survey asked children to identify their favorite activities from the event. The top responses included face painting, storytelling sessions, a science experiment station, and a puppet show. These activities showcased the children's inclination towards creative expression, imagination, and hands-on learning. 2. Educational Impact: A significant number of participants expressed their enthusiasm for the educational exhibits and interactive games. They appreciated the opportunity to learn about science, nature, and the environment through engaging exhibits and age-appropriate demonstrations. This highlights the importance of providing learning opportunities that are both educational and enjoyable for young children. 3. Suggestions for Improvement: The survey also provided an opportunity for children to offer suggestions for future events. Some of the common suggestions included adding more interactive games, incorporating more animal-related activities, and enhancing the storytelling sessions with props and visuals. Their suggestions clearly indicate their desire for more immersive experiences and diverse forms of engagement. 4. Positive Feedback: The survey revealed an overwhelming sense of satisfaction and delight among the participants. Many children expressed their excitement about attending similar events in the future. The positive feedback from the children reinforces the success of the event in providing a memorable experience that resonated with their interests and needs.
